  • This video provides an overview of the key respiratory symptoms you'd be expected to cover when taking a comprehensive respiratory history in an OSCE station including:
    - Shortness of breath (dyspnoea)
    - Chest pain
    - Cough
    - Haemoptysis
    - Systemic symptoms (e.g. weight loss/gain, fever, malaise)
